Having recently taken possession of a new 28i M sport with DHP, I can say I would not purchase the vehicle without it, regardless of the extra cost. The switch you are referencing has the same function regardless of DHP or not (at least in the US). The mode switch will place steering, transmission, and throttle response into sport mode (more responsive) on all the X3s, but does not affect the handling. DHP adds the suspension into the mix with the same switch, and will affect the handling - in a very good way. The DHP makes the X3 feel like a BMW. Like others have said, it is not possible to get DDC without DHP. A bit confusing (ok, very confusing), but a search will confirm this to be the case for all who have tried.
